Lynn Ban: A Comprehensive Biographical Profile
Lynn Ban was a multi-hyphenate creative force whose influence spanned the globe, connecting Singaporean roots with the high-fashion energy of New York City. Her life was defined by a fearless approach to style and an entrepreneurial spirit.
- Full Name: Lynn Ban (Simplified Chinese: 万爱萍)
- Born: May 27, 1972, in Singapore
- Died: January 20, 2025, in New York, USA (following complications from a ski accident)
- Age at Death: 52
- Nationality: Singaporean
- Residences: Singapore and New York City
- Profession: Celebrity Jewelry Designer, Business Owner, Reality Television Personality
- Company: Lynn Ban Jewelry
- Signature Style: Avant-garde, provocative, bold, and unconventional designs often featuring precious metals and stones in unexpected forms (e.g., skeletal, spiked, or architectural motifs).
- Notable Clients: Rihanna, Beyoncé, Lady Gaga, Madonna, Taylor Swift, and Katy Perry.
- Reality TV Role: Cast member on the Netflix series *Bling Empire: New York*.
The Tragic Aspen Ski Accident: A Detailed Timeline
The incident that ultimately led to Lynn Ban’s untimely passing unfolded over a period of several weeks, beginning during a festive family vacation. The details shared by her family and public statements paint a picture of a sudden, life-altering event.
1. The Incident on Christmas Eve
The ski accident occurred on Christmas Eve, December 24, in Aspen, Colorado. Lynn Ban was enjoying a vacation with her family on a beautiful, sunny day when she suffered a fall on the mountain. Initially, the extent of her injuries was not immediately apparent, a common and dangerous characteristic of certain head traumas.
2. Emergency Brain Surgery and Critical Injuries
Following the fall, and after experiencing severe symptoms, the reality star was rushed for medical attention. Doctors discovered she had sustained serious brain injuries. She underwent emergency brain surgery shortly after the accident in late December.
Lynn Ban herself took to social media to update her followers on the gravity of the situation, sharing the difficult news of the surgery and the long road of recovery that lay ahead. This public sharing highlighted her resilience and transparency even during a deeply personal health crisis.
3. The Weeks-Long Battle for Recovery
For several weeks following the surgery, Lynn Ban remained in a critical state as she fought to recover from the severe trauma. The nature of the brain injuries and subsequent complications proved overwhelming. The fashion and reality TV worlds monitored the situation closely, sending an outpouring of support and well wishes through social media platforms.
4. The Tragic Passing in January 2025
Tragically, Lynn Ban passed away on January 20, 2025, due to complications arising from the brain injuries sustained in the Aspen ski accident. Her death, at the age of 52, came less than a month after the initial incident and subsequent emergency surgery, leaving her family, friends, and fans in profound grief.

The Avant-Garde Jewelry Empire
Lynn Ban’s jewelry brand was synonymous with provocation and luxury. Her pieces were not merely accessories; they were statements. She redefined high-end jewelry with her unconventional designs, moving away from traditional, delicate forms toward a more aggressive, architectural, and rock-and-roll aesthetic.
Key characteristics of her brand, Lynn Ban Jewelry, included:
- Bold Motifs: Skulls, spikes, chains, and reptilian textures.
- Luxurious Materials: High-karat gold, diamonds, and precious gemstones.
- Celebrity Endorsement: Her designs were frequently featured in major fashion spreads, including those shot by Steven Meisel, and were a staple for music icons like Rihanna and Beyoncé, establishing her as a go-to designer for red-carpet shock and awe.
Her work was celebrated for turning passion into a sparkling empire, demonstrating that fine jewelry could be both high-fashion and rebellious. The designer often spoke about her desire to create pieces that were timeless yet entirely modern, ensuring her artistic mark would endure.
The 'Bling Empire: New York' Star
Lynn Ban gained a new level of global recognition as a cast member on the Netflix reality series *Bling Empire: New York*. Her sharp wit, impeccable style, and candid approach to life made her a fan favorite. The show introduced her vibrant personality and luxurious lifestyle to millions, showcasing her as a formidable figure in the New York social and fashion scenes.
Her interactions with other cast members, including Dorothy Wang, Nam Laks, and Blake Abbie, provided many memorable moments. The show served as a platform not only for her personal life but also for her professional expertise as a designer, further cementing her status as a pop culture icon.
